Output 053d1886250b6d319ea9178df953098bcacfc30a297be901347b42f6a5f16392:0

value
698730215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6b6a1b834693877446d862094b3495d2e858a6 OP_EQUAL
address
3JxaK66tcFJa9gFF7jFfo6EwsE6MU35w7t
transaction
053d1886250b6d319ea9178df953098bcacfc30a297be901347b42f6a5f16392
spent
true